The interj. hail is thus an abbreviated sentence expressing a wish, 'be whole,' i. e., be in good health, and equiv. to L. salve, … WebThe best known hail-storm in the Bible is the seventh plague which God inflicted on the Egyptians immediately before the Exodus ( Exodus 9:13-35; Ps. c. ). On another occasion hail served as God's destroying agent; and it is said that those who died from hailstones were more than those who died by the sword of Israel ( Joshua 10:11 ). Web"Hail fellow well met" is an English idiom used when referring to a person whose behavior is hearty, friendly, and congenial, in the affirmative sense.
